autoclick bookmark folders
The one feature in Safari I like is 'autoclick' bookmark folders. You can select this for any folder in the bookmarks bar. The contents of these folders will open in tabs but just clicking on them one, plus these tabs will replace other open tabs. Is this plannend for OW at all??

In OmniWeb you do have the Command and Command-Option options. Holding one of these as you click on a folder will open the tabs within a folder in new tabs or replace the existing tabs with new tabs respectively.
